Letter, Sherman [W. T.] & Ewing [Thomas] to Thomas A. Thompson Author: Sherman & Ewing Date: November 3, 1858 One of the partners addressed this letter regarding the use of military land warrants in the territory to Thomas A. Thompson at Summit Point, Jefferson Co., Virginia. "Sherman & Ewing informed Thompson that such warrants could not be used to acquire land until after the public sale in July 1859, but some advice was offered for the interim.
